Review
The Goodman 2.5-ton horizontal gas furnace and air conditioner system occupies a practical middle ground in the budget HVAC market. This combination unit pairs an 80% AFUE gas furnace producing 60,000 BTU of heating with a 14 SEER air conditioner capable of 30,000 BTU cooling. At this price point, it's positioned as a no-frills replacement option for homeowners tired of paying premium pricing, though efficiency numbers reflect an entry-level rather than advanced specification.
Performance-wise, this system uses a high-efficiency multi-speed blower motor capable of 1,200 CFM maximum airflow, which helps extract more value from the furnace and coil. The dual-stage burner design allows the furnace to modulate heat output for better comfort and efficiency than single-stage alternatives. However, the 14 SEER rating and single-stage condenser mean cooling efficiency drops significantly during partial-load conditions common in spring and fall when you don't need full capacity. The 72 dB noise level is audible during operation, something to consider if your equipment room is near living spaces.

Installation
This horizontal configuration requires minimal ductwork modifications, making it ideal for tight attic or basement installations. The unit demands 208/230V single-phase power with breaker sizing between 17.1 and 25 amps, standard for most residential electrical panels. Metal exhaust flue is required, and proper refrigerant line sizing (3/8-inch liquid, 3/4-inch suction) with insulation must be maintained. Installation difficulty is moderate for licensed technicians familiar with Goodman systems.
Warranty & Reliability
The 10-year parts warranty kicks in with online registration, covering components like the compressor and coil. This is competitive for budget-tier systems but shorter than some premium manufacturer warranties. Registration is mandatory to activate coverage, so save documentation at installation. Labor costs beyond warranty period fall on the homeowner.
